Syracuse.com boys hockey rankings (through Week 3): New No. 1 after state champs dethroned

The Rome Free Academy boys hockey team moved up to No. 1 in the latest syracuse.com rankings after defeating three-time defending state champion Skaneateles New Hartford last week. Mark DiOrio | Contributing photo

Syracuse, NY – Three-time defending champion Skaneateles suffered its first loss in 26 games last week and is now the new No. 1 boys hockey team in the syracuse.com weekly rankings.

That team, Rome Free Academy, is one of the last two undefeated teams in Section III. Baldwinsville is the second team at 3-0-2.

New Hartford moved up three spots after handing Skaneateles its first loss since Dec. 4, 2024.
